AMC Networks’ Unit Sued for Sharing Video-Viewing Information

Aug. 7, 2023, 7:14 PM UTC

Anime video streamer Sentai Filmworks LLC disclosed the private video consumption habits of consumers without their consent to third parties in violation of federal and state privacy laws, a new proposed federal class action said.

Patrick James alleged that Sentai installed the Meta Platforms tracking pixel on its website, a snipped of computer code that transmitted to Facebook a record of every video he and class members watched on the site, along with the Facebook ID of visitors who were Facebook users.
